Sauber Sign New Partnership Agreement

Friday October 26th, 2001

The Sauber team announced on Friday they have signed an agreement with Paninfo AG, who will provide the Swiss outfit with information technology hardware and services starting in January, 2002.

"As Formula One becomes more and more competitive, information technology becomes more and more important," said team boss Peter Sauber. "The development and operation of our race cars require high-performance IT that is absolutely reliable.

"I am sure that, with Paninfo AG we have found a partner that will meet our high expectations."

Paninfo, a Switzerland-based company like Sauber, works exclusively with IBM products and has been a market player since 1978.

"Paninfo has deep and proven experience in planning, implementing and servicing complex IT solutions," Paninfo CEO Kurt D. Weber said. "With our products and our know-how, we are sure that we will contribute to the future success of the Sauber team."
